Handover — SplitGate assignment service

Welcome aboard. SplitGate hands out A/B bucket assignments; it's stateless except for the salt cache. Don't touch bucketing logic without sign-off from Priya. Deploys go through Larkspur CI, twice weekly. Known quirk: sticky assignments reset if the salt rotates early. Current production configuration is below.

service settings:
[casax]
port = 6379
team = rusir
host = casax.zemvarhq.corp
region = outer-4
access_code = ac_9808ce
timeout_ms = 1500

## tailcli Access

The `tailcli` tool streams application logs from the Bramblewick aggregation tier. Auth is handled via short-lived workspace tokens; no long-term credentials are cached locally. Scope is read-only. Audit events for every tail session land in the `cli_audit` table on the metrics host. For review purposes, sessions can be replayed from that table directly; connect using the string below.

replica DSN, kajep-yahag: mssql://praok_svc:iF@db-8d68.plorvaio.local:5432/eliion

## Authentication

Heads up: the nightly reindex job (`reindex_nightly.py`) talks to the Lanternfish search cluster, and that cluster won't accept anonymous writes anymore — we locked it down last sprint. The job now authenticates as the `reindex-runner` service identity against Corvid Gateway, and the token is injected via the `LF_INDEX_TOKEN` env var in the scheduler config. Nothing clever going on, just a bearer header on every batch request. For review purposes, the staging credential currently in use is listed below.

service key, kadug-kadup: kto15_rN23XLAYImmZgrJ

Minutes — Management Meeting, Project Larkspur

Attendees: R. Venn, T. Okafor, M. Hiller. Larkspur remains eight weeks behind; integration testing slipped again. Vendor Quillbrook blamed for late deliverables. Budget hold approved until revised schedule lands. Incoming director to review staffing before month-end. The confidential note on forward business plans follows below.

board note of bajop-yaweg: The western region missed its Pelys quota by 58.0 percent last quarter. Pelysek Foods plans to raise the Belius list price by 44.0 percent in July. The steering committee signed off on a budget of $133.8 million for Project Pelax. The renewal with Zoraelix Systems closes at $61.9 million a year, 12.7 percent above the last contract.